FCS Security Requests

FCS Security requests are submitted through Jira or ServiceNow and are categorized below:
- Jira
- Firewall change request
- Account Creation & Deletion
- ServiceNow
- Security Scan Request
- Report a Lost Item
- Report a Stolen Item
- Security Training Compliance
Visit the Requests page for direct links to submit specific requests. Further support can be found on the FCS Tenant Quick Reference Guide and the Cloud Support Center.
